BETH HART IN CONCERT:
For more than two decades, blues singer-songwriter Beth Hart has been moving audiences with her soulful voice, heartrending lyrics, and finely crafted songs about love and loss. Hart is a storyteller of the first order, delivering world-wise songs like "LA Song (Out of This Town)" and "Leave the Light On" with an honesty and intensity that make her concerts an unforgettable experience. Whether she's sharing the stage with legendary guitarist Joe Bonamassa or playing with her supremely talented band, Hart is a world-class performer whose passionate and confessional live shows satisfy on every level.
BACKGROUND SNAPSHOT:
Beth Hart was born and raised in Los Angeles, CA, where she began playing the club scene in her early twenties. In 1993 she made several appearances on Ed McMahon's Star Search, going on to win the season's Female Vocalist prize thanks to her emotive voice and heart-on-sleeve performances. That same year she released her debut album Beth Hart and the Ocean of Souls, an auspicious collection of songs that featured the fan favorite "Am I the One". She put together a band for 1996's Immortal, and in 1999 the lineup achieved breakthrough success with the album Screaming for My Supper. The record's lead single "LA Song (Out of This Town)" cracked the Top 5 on the soft rock charts and reached No. 1 in New Zealand. Hart continued to work with a rotating lineup of musicians on subsequent releases including 2003's Leave the Light On and 2007's 37 Days. In 2013 she and Joe Bonamassa topped the Blues Albums chart with Seesaw, a critically acclaimed collaboration that earned a Best Blues Album nomination at the 2014 Grammy Awards.
